Résumé

This research focuses on existing practices for soil improvement by developing and implementing mathematical and analytical simulations of the soil's dynamic response to dynamic loads during the vibro-compaction process. The results of parametric modeling using rheological models will enable a realistic assessment of soil behavior, considering the effects of the compaction process and controlling technological parameters through a predictive model. Experimental testing correlated with numerical tools can be applied to identify reliable solutions, both technically and economically, for compacted soils, thus ensuring high-quality engineering compaction works and improving design techniques.
